What is the difference between Spacecraft Systems Engineer vs Satellite Systems Engineer?
| Aspect | Spacecraft Systems Engineer | Satellite Systems Engineer |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Bachelor's or Master's in Aerospace, Mechanical, or Electrical Engineering; certifications like INCOSE | Bachelor's or Master's in Electrical, Aerospace, or Systems Engineering; similar certifications |
| Work Environment | Design, develop, and test spacecraft for space missions | Design, develop, and maintain satellite systems for communication, navigation, or Earth observation |
| Employer & Industry Usage | NASA, SpaceX, Boeing, aerospace firms | Satellite service providers, aerospace companies, defense contractors |
| Common Search & Comparison | High overlap in skills and certifications; both focus on complex systems engineering |
Both roles require strong systems engineering skills, relevant certifications, and work in aerospace or satellite industries. The main difference lies in their focus: spacecraft systems engineers work on space exploration vehicles, while satellite systems engineers focus on satellite technology and operations.

The Boeing CompanyBoeing Defense, Space & Security's (BDS's), Experimental Systems Group (ESG) seeks a Spacecraft Systems Engineer to join our team in either Seal Beach, CA; Aurora, CO; or El Segundo, CA. This is an opportunity to personally contribute to the development of new first-of-kind space vehicles and missions. The ESG portfolio consists of a range of platforms and technologies including the X-37B, the world's first fully autonomous reusable spaceplane, which is continuing to shape the future of space technology while currently flying its eighth mission.
As a member of our Systems Engineering Integration & Test (SEIT) Mission Design team, you work with a system architects, Concept of Operations (ConOps) developers, fault and autonomy designers, and Recommended Operating Procedure (ROP) authors.
Our development timelines are aggressive and you will be asked to develop solutions to previously unsolved problems. You will need to be able to dive into broad, minimally-defined design spaces and effectively lead integrated efforts.
Position Responsibilities:
- Coordinate internal and external stakeholders to drive development and implementation of an optimal fault and autonomy architecture for your assigned program(s).
- Be the point of contact for customers and work directly with subject matter experts to quickly identify achievable solutions that meet customer needs.
- Support technology integration for and development of first-of-kind space vehicles and missions.
- Develop and present review packages to internal and external senior leadership.
- Ensure system hardware designs have adequate redundancy for required levels of fault tolerance.
- Develop autonomy aligned with customer risk tolerance in the presence of anomalies.
- Analyze system failure modes via failure mode effects and criticality analysis (FMECA) or fault tree analysis.
- Develop software requirements for onboard fault protection to detect and isolate failures and transition to spacecraft safing modes.
- Design autonomy or ground procedures to recover from failures.
- Provide occasional on-call support for system anomalies.
